1) Cross Device Tracking

Think about how you browse the Internet.

You don’t use just one device. Instead, you probably go from work computer to smart phone to home computer, right? 

And as you switch back and forth, you expect some kind of consistency in the content you see. 

Potential customers are no different. They might read about your product on their phone, then decide to actually buy it once they’ve gotten to a computer.

Your affiliate marketing strategy needs to be able to track their behavior, regardless of the device they’re using.

3) Content Focus

Now, don’t take this to mean that using coupons or deals to drive in those affiliate clicks is a bad thing. It’s not. 

There will always be customers out there who are motivated to click ‘buy’ because of a good deal. 

But if you want to create repeat customers, relying on things like coupons is just not going to work. 

Instead, focus on content. If someone purchases your product because they like what they see — not just because it’s cheap — they’re more likely to be confident in their decision. 

They’ve probably done their research. Maybe they’re convinced that they need what you’re offering.

That customer is way more likely to become loyal to your brand. 

Focusing on content requires patience, but it’s worth the wait. 

4) Performance-Based Models

Performance-based models are useful for a couple reasons. 

First, most companies are thrilled to pay only when there are measurable results, instead of throwing money at a strategy and hoping it works. 

Second, with the amount of data available, it’s easy to analyze the performance of each ad, and then tailor affiliate marketing strategies. 

Even though people have been using these models for years, performance-based models will probably gain popularity in 2018 since they’re so wallet friendly. 

5) Refer-A-Friend

It’s conventional wisdom that people are more likely to listen to people they trust. 

Refer-A-Friend programs are another cost-effective move to add to your 2018 affiliate marketing strategy. 

Getting existing customers to spread the word to their friends not only expands your audience reach, but it’s also cheaper than traditional methods.

If you create incentives for customers to email Mom, Aunt Sally, and the couple in Apartment B about your product, they’ll do the marketing for you…for free.

6) Influencer Marketing

Influencer marketing basically combines the best aspects of refer-a-friend and a content focus. 

The subscribers or followers of a popular YouTube personality, for example, follow that person because of the content they put out. Those subscribers are the perfect example of loyal customers. 

If that YouTuber endorses a product, you can bet that their subscribers are going to buy it. 

This is a win for everyone — you get to build your brand and hopefully expand your audience, while the YouTuber gets some cash in their pocket every time a subscriber clicks their affiliate link.

9) Video

If you haven’t already incorporated video into your affiliate marketing strategy, start making your plan now. 

The stats of online video don’t lie — four times as many customers would rather watch a video about a product than read about it. And after they’ve watched it, they’ve got about an 80% chance of remembering it a week later. 

A week! 

Using video not only grabs customers’ attention, it connects you with them. Video can also help raise your brand’s perception.

You can make videos about a variety of topics — a product, your staff, your company’s origin story. Whatever you choose, make it short, sweet, and engaging. 

10) Automation

Finally, as the affiliate field continues to grow and companies get bigger, brands will be less likely to spend lots of time on repetitive tasks. 

Instead, a likely 2018 affiliate marketing trend is automation. More companies will create and run programs that can monitor the heaps of data.

In the meantime, the actual employees can turn their focus to more important things, hopefully creating even more revenue for the company!
